Meaning of resurge

The primary meaning of the word "resurge" is to rise or increase again after a period of decline or dormancy.

Etymology of resurge

The word "resurge" comes from the Latin words "re" meaning "again" and "surgere" meaning "to rise"
Historically, the word has been used since the 17th century to describe the act of rising or increasing again after a period of decline

Definitions

  • To rise or increase again after a period of decline or dormancy
  • * To become strong or active again
  • * To reappear or come back into existence

Usage Examples

  • The economy began to resurge after the recession
  • * The company's sales resurged after the launch of their new product
  • * The artist's popularity resurged after the release of their new album
